take the puppy to a groomer to have the ears completely shaved and either have the ears taped up or tape them up yourself. There are instructional websites if you google it on exactly how to tape them. | |
Posted 09-01-2008 at 05:03 PM by m102262 |
Hey I had a pup that her ears didnt stand, so i shaved the ears, cut a straw the length of the ears, and then folded the ears lengthwise around the straw. then placed a piece of tape to center it across the ears. volia.. it worked. | |
